Job Title:Head Start Lead Teacher

Report to:Director of Early Childhood Education

Compensation:$53,000 to $57,000 Annually

Status:Full time (Monday thru Friday 8:30am to 5pm, Year-round)

Location:Chicago, IL

Northwestern University Settlement House has been supporting children and families through high-quality education and community programming for over a century. We are proud to offer a collaborative, mission-driven environment where children thrive and educators grow. We are currently seeking a dedicated and passionate Lead Teacher for our Head Start Program who holds a Professional Educator License (PEL). As a Lead Teacher, you will be responsible for developing and implementing individualized education plans that promote the intellectual, social, emotional, and physical growth of each child.

You’ll work under the general supervision of the Director of Early Childhood Education and in compliance with Head Start Performance Standards, NAEYC Standards, and Community Partnership CPS requirements.

Responsibilities
  • Create and maintain a safe, supportive, and inclusive learning environment.
  • Develop and implement lesson plans aligned with Creative Curriculum, NAEYC, and Head Start standards.
  • Supervise and evaluate assistant teachers, teacher aides, and classroom volunteers.
  • Facilitate learning experiences in early literacy, math, science, music, arts, and social-emotional development.
  • Ensure classroom materials and physical setup support optimal child development.
  • Maintain accurate records, child assessments, and documentation.
  • Participate in parent-teacher conferences and family engagement activities.
  • Collaborate with Family Workers and educational consultants for child development and referrals.
  • Plan and lead classroom field trips and related activities.
  • Attend staff meetings, trainings, and professional development workshops.
  • Support and guide classroom behavior using developmentally appropriate practices.
Qualifications
  • Bachelor’s Degree in Early Childhood Education or related field
  • Professional Educator License (PEL) in Early Childhood Education
  • ECE Level 5 Credential
  • 2–5 years of experience teaching preschool-aged children
  • Bilingual English/Spanish strongly preferred
  • CPR/First Aid Certification (or willing to complete within first year)
  • Strong knowledge of child development and early learning standards
  • Excellent communication, leadership, and collaboration skills
Physical &

Work Environment Requirements
  • Must be able to lift and carry up to 50 lbs.
  • Ability to sit on the floor, bend, stoop, kneel, and actively participate in child-centered activities.
  • Punctual and consistent attendance is essential to effectively fulfill the responsibilities of this position.
  • Able to work in a variety of noise levels—from quiet offices to lively playgrounds.
